KATHMANDU: Nepal Scout has announced local scout committees at all 753 local levels.

The Nepal Scouts announced the committees and have appointed coordinators in all the municipalities.

According to Lok Bahadur Bhandari, National Coordinator of Nepal Scout, more than 4,000 youths have been produced as scoutmasters through state-level basic scout training.

He informed that currently, 75,000 youths are members of the Scout adding that the local scout committee would form scouts in every school within its jurisdiction and include youths between the ages of 6 and 25 in the scout.

He said that there are currently 65,000 community and institutional schools with scout structures.
